  1. The short of it is that I have never had an aquarium or kept fish. I started working from home and thought it would be cool to have a tank next to my desk for lookin' at during zoom calls. I have had this going since June 2020. Earliest picture I could find: Tank as it sits now: I have some questions for you guys with more experience. I put snails in my tank (dumb idea) and they are exploding in population. Pretty much taking over the place. Based on the snail-plosion, I have deduced that i have been over feeding the tank. How should go about reducing snail population while not starving out my other bottom dwellers? I have shrimp, hillstreams, and kuhli loaches in the tank that compete with snails for food. What are some ways I can determine how much i should be feeding? The plants I got from aquarium co-op have been a lot of fun to tinker with. Plant stuff is as interesting as the fish stuff now.
